Obtaining a Driver's License in Austria: The Online Process

Acquiring a driver's license in Austria can be an amazing yet challenging prospect for newcomers and people alike. With a blend of theoretical and useful training, the process makes sure that motorists are well-prepared for the roads. As innovation advances, lots of administrative services have transitioned online, making it easier for applicants to navigate the licensing procedure. This article will explore the actions required to get a driver's license in Austria via online services, in addition to some frequently asked concerns about the process.

Steps to Obtain a Driver's License Online

1. Preparation and Eligibility

Before diving into the online process, it's important to examine eligibility. The minimum age varies based on the license classification, as revealed in the table above. People should also meet particular health and mental prerequisites. For instance, a health certificate might be needed to guarantee that applicants are fit to drive.

2. Online Registration

The primary step in the application procedure is online registration. Applicants must check out the official Austrian federal government site or the dedicated website for driver's licenses. Here, they require to offer individual info, including:

  • Name
  • Address
  • Date of birth
  • Nationality
  • Identity confirmation (e.g., passport, nationwide ID)

3. Theory Course Enrollment

Upon effective registration, applicants need to register in a theoretical driving course. Lots of driving schools in Austria provide courses that can be gone to online. These courses cover necessary elements of road security, traffic rules, and automobile handling. In general, you should anticipate:

  • A minimum of 32 hours of theoretical training.
  • Research study materials provided in numerous formats, including videos, slides, and quizzes.

4. Complete the Theory Exam

When the theory course is finished, applicants must pass a theoretical examination. The primary points covered consist of:

  • Road signs
  • Traffic regulations
  • Safe driving practices

The theoretical exam is generally conducted online, offering versatility and comfort for the applicants. A passing score is needed to progress in the procedure.

5. Practical Driving Training

Following the effective conclusion of the theoretical examination, candidates require to undergo practical driving lessons. Here's a breakdown of what to anticipate:

6. Pass the Practical Driving Test

After completing the required lessons, applicants will require to pass a useful driving test. The screening areas are typically run by local authorities. The practical test assesses:

  • Basic vehicle controls
  • Roadway maneuvers
  • Traffic navigation
  • Emergency handling

7. Receiving the Driver's License

Upon successfully passing both the theoretical and useful tests, applicants can apply for their driver's license online. They will need to publish the following documents:

  • Proof of successful conclusion of both exams
  • Identity confirmation
  • Health certificate (if needed)
  • Payment record for costs

As soon as the application is processed, the driver's license will be issued, generally within a couple of weeks.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: Can I request a driver's license in Austria if I hold a foreign license?

Yes, people with a foreign driver's license may be able to exchange it for an Austrian license, depending upon the native land and particular policies. They must talk to local authorities for details.

Q2: What is the expense associated with acquiring a driver's license in Austria?

The overall expense can differ widely based upon the category of the license, the driving school selected, and any extra expenses such as health certificates. On average, anticipate to spend between EUR1,000 and EUR2,000.

Q3: How long is an Austrian driver's license legitimate?

An Austrian driver's license is typically legitimate for 15 years, after which it needs to be restored.

Q4: Is there a particular timeframe I must complete the procedure in?

While there is no rigorous due date, it's suggested to complete the theory and useful tests within one to 2 years from the start of the procedure to prevent losing any fees or course credits.

Q5: Can I take my theoretical test in English?

Numerous driving schools offer the theoretical test in numerous languages. Applicants need to validate with their selected school regarding language schedule.
